Indulge in Luxurious Villas in Sintra, Portugal

Sintra, a charming town nestled in the heart of Portugal, is renowned for its stunning palaces and enchanting forests. Wishing for an unforgettable getaway? Discover a range of opulent villas that offer exceptional comfort and panoramic views. Nestled in the verdant hills, these villas offer a serene escape from the hullabaloo of everyday life. A

read more

Charming Homes in Sintra

Nestled within the lush forests of Sintra, Portugal, stand a assemblage of breathtaking villas. These traditional homes offer a special blend of Mediterranean charm and updated comfort, making them the ideal retreat for those seeking an unforgettable getaway. From ample living areas to lush gardens and breathtaking views, these villas provide a lu

read more